DATE SEVEN

DATE SEVEN
Datesebun - Miyagi

DATE SEVEN is a limited edition sake brand brewed by seven leading breweries in Miyagi Prefecture coming together. Under a different concept each year, seven brewery owners and master brewers (toji) share processes such as koji making, yeast starter production, and mash management, jointly brewing a single sake. The fusion of each brewery's techniques and personalities creates a unique taste that cannot be born alone. In SEASON2, the style has evolved to allow comparison of seven different personalities by using the same rice and having each brewery brew with their own method. It is a brand that symbolizes the diversity of sake brewing in Miyagi and the strong cooperation between breweries, embodying the will to enliven the sake culture throughout the region. With limited distribution, there are sake fans nationwide who look forward to the release on July 7th every year.

W

W
Watanabe Sake Brewery - Gifu 飛騨市

"W" is an innovative brand with three meanings: Watanabe (Watanabe Sake Brewery), World, and Warai (Laughter). It unifies specs such as rice polishing ratio and yeast, expressing differences in taste only through differences in sake rice varieties. Designed to allow you to directly enjoy the individuality of diverse sake rice, it proposes new ways to enjoy sake and brings smiles to people all over the world.

Chimatsushima

千松島
Chimatsushima - Miyagi 仙台市青葉区

Chimatsushima is a historic brand named after "Chimatsushima," an ancient name for Matsushima Bay, and has been loved as a local sake of Sendai for many years. Featuring a light and dry quality using Sasanishiki rice from Miyagi Prefecture, it balances a nimble and sharp mouthfeel with a delicate aroma. With a dry Sake Meter Value of +3, it has low acidity and a subtle sweetness can be felt, possessing a versatility that can be enjoyed both as cold sake and warm sake. It goes well with Western food as well as Japanese food, and is characterized by a refreshing aftertaste that you won't tire of, making it loved as a daily sake that enriches the daily dining table. It is a brand that stays close to Sendai's food culture, realizing a clean aftertaste while bringing out the umami of rice through traditional brewing techniques.

Hida no Dobu

飛騨のどぶ
Watanabe Sake Brewery - Gifu 飛騨市

"Hida no Dobu" is a very popular Nigori sake recreating the secret taste treated at the "Doburoku Festival" in the World Heritage Shirakawa-go. About 5.4 trillion yeasts are alive in 1.8 liters, characterized by overwhelming concentration and creamy texture. With a rich taste like "eating" rather than "drinking," it captivates fans all over the country.
